As a Senior Infrastructure Engineer (Database Specialist), you will work in an Agile fast-paced environment helping to deliver and maintain database products and solutions. Already a skilled Practitioner and role model, you will ensure best practices are adhered to and guide teams on how to deliver and support quality database products.

In addition, you will be responsible for the design, implementation, configuration, maintenance of critical database platforms in the cloud and on-premise, to ensure the availability and consistent performance of our products and services within agreed service levels.

Person specification

The ideal candidate will have a proven track record as a Database Infrastructure Engineer or Database Administrator, and you will have experience of:

  • Providing effective database management and support gained in very large, highly available, enterprise-class environments.
  • Technical experience should include, but not limited to, database provisioning, security, backups and restores and on-premises to cloud migrations, with an emphasis on Oracle technology.
Responsibilities
  • Proactively contribute to the Database Engineering Community of Practice by providing technical leadership and mentorship to less experienced team members.
  • Manage databases through multiple product lifecycle environments, from development to mission-critical production systems on-premise and Cloud IaaS and PaaS environments.
  • Configure and maintain database servers, including monitoring of system health and performance, to ensure optimum levels of performance, availability, security, and automation.
  • Support architects and developers to ensure design, development and implementation support efforts meet integration and performance expectations.
  • Independently analyse, tackle, and correct issues in real time, providing problem resolution end-to-end.
  • Refine and automate regular processes, track issues, and document changes.
  • Assist developers with complex query tuning, schema refinement and cloud migration approaches.
Essential Criteria
  • Expertise in Oracle Database (19c and above), including Grid Infrastructure, Recovery Manager, Data Guard.
  • Expertise in database management, performance tuning and SQL optimisation.
  • Expertise in provisioning databases on Linux platforms.
  • Practitioner level knowledge of Cloud infrastructure technologies such as AWS and Microsoft Azure, IaaS- and PaaS-based database solutions.
  • Practitioner level skills in Linux OS and scripting.
  • Working knowledge of DevOps practices, continuous delivery tooling (for example, Terraform, Ansible, Git) and database automation using the aforementioned tools.
  • Must hold, or be eligible to obtain Security Clearance (SC).
